THE KEY IDEA

Choose the coast for your month

Sri Lanka Tourism describes four climate seasons and two monsoon periods. The southwest monsoon mainly affects the southwest coast and hills from May to September, while the northeast monsoon is December to February.

SOUTH & WEST

November to March is the classic beach window

Sri Lanka Tourism says northeast winds make the southwestern coast sunnier and the sea calmer from roughly November to March.

EAST COAST

The east can be the better beach choice in the European summer

During the southwest monsoon, the dry-zone and east-coast destinations such as Trincomalee and Arugam Bay can offer better conditions than the southwest.

What is the best month for Sri Lanka?

It depends on your route. For the south and southwest coast, roughly November to March is a classic choice.

Is Sri Lanka bad in July?

Not necessarily. July can suit the east coast better than the southwest.

Does Sri Lanka have two monsoons?

Yes. The southwest and northeast monsoons affect different parts of the island.
